Economy & Jobs
City of Creede residents earn a median household income of $49,375 , which is 34%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$29,632. The unemployment rate stands at 5.1% (42% above the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 6.0%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 500 business establishments, including 53 restaurants.
Housing & Cost of Living
The median home value in City of Creede is $315,400 , 12% above the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$431,040. Median rent is $920/month, with 31.1%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 103.1 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1973.
Safety & Crime
City of Creede reports 757 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 99% above the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 6,112/100K.
Education
40.1% of adults in City of Creede hold a bachelor's degree or higher (19% above the national average). 97.8% have completed high school. Local schools score 4.9/10 in standardized testing.
Climate & Weather
City of Creede has an average annual temperature of 41°F (5°C). Winters average 21°F in January while summers reach 61°F in July. The area gets 330 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 15.7 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 41.
